Abstract

Solar air heaters, having artificially roughened absorber plate exhibit improved thermal and thermohydraulic performances. In an outdoor experimental investigation, thermal and thermohydraulic efficiencies of multiple v-rib roughened solar air heaters were evaluated for Reynolds number range of 3000 to 15100. It has been observed that use of multiple v-rib type of roughness on the underside of the absorber plate of a solar air heater resulted in 51 per cent improvement in thermal efficiency along with three fold increase in frictional losses as compared to conventional solar air heater having smooth absorber plate. Effective efficiency of the multiple v-rib roughened solar air heaters has been found to be about 1.5 times that of conventional solar air heaters. Effective efficiency of multiple v-rib roughened solar air heaters tested under outdoor and indoor conditions has been found to differ between 12 and 22.5 per cent
